Best 99577 Alaska Public Elementary Schools (2025)

For the 2025 school year, there are 8 public elementary schools serving 2,615 students in 99577, AK.
The top ranked public elementary schools in 99577, AK are Eagle Academy Charter School, Ravenwood Elementary School and Distance Learning/corresp. Center.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Public elementary schools in zipcode 99577 have an average math proficiency score of 53% (versus the Alaska public elementary school average of 33%), and reading proficiency score of 45% (versus the 30% statewide average). Elementary schools in 99577, AK have an average ranking of 9/10, which is in the top 20% of Alaska public elementary schools.
Minority enrollment is 35%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the Alaska public elementary school average of 53% (majority American Indian).
